Brief introduction of Uighur Medicine (kuxitai method)

Applicant: Institute of Uygur Medicine of Xinjiang Uygur Autonomous Region

Uighur medicine has a long history, distinct regional and ethnic characteristics, unique basic theory and rich clinical experience, and occupies an important position in the treasure house of traditional medicine in China.

"Kuxitai" is literally translated as burning or death in Uyghur, which refers to the method of heating and refining medicine with certain appliances and accessories or ingredients. It is mainly divided into: 1. "Geyikemaiti" mud sealing and closed refining method: this method is also known as "bottling refining method", which refers to the method of putting medicine into the bottle, covering the bottle mouth well, and using red clay, wheat or barley at the mouth and outside of the bottle. 2. "Gelikemaiti" mud package method: it refers to the method of directly wrapping the medicine with "gelikemaiti" mud and heating it with warm fire. This method is mostly used to refine Croton, castor seed, nutmeg, aloe, light powder, etc. 3. Pot refining method: it refers to the method of directly putting the medicine into the pot and heating it with warm fire. This method is mostly used to refine alum, borax, coral, pearl, copper, gypsum, aragonite, sulfur, saltpeter, etc. 4. Fuming refining method: it refers to the method of heating the medicine, generating smoke, and scraping down the solid smoke for standby. The specific methods are as follows: grind the medicine into fine powder, place it in the pot, heat it to yellow, cover it with a bowl, put three layers of salting paper at the contact between the pot and bowl, and seal it with clay mud; fill it with sand until the pot mouth, put two grains of rice at the bottom of the bowl, and press it with two pieces of soil; first heat it with warm fire for 1 hour, and gradually increase the firepower, when the rice at the bottom of the bowl turns yellow, reduce the firepower and continue to use warm water When the rice turns black, stop heating. Remove the sand and clay. Then scrape the powder off the bowl with a knife. This method is mostly used to refine mercury, cinnabar, realgar, etc. 5. Heating dropping distillation method: it refers to the method of dropping distillation of effective components of drugs by heating the drugs in the pot. The specific method is as follows: put the medicine in a bottle with a small hole, align the bottom with the retort, and heat around the bottle to make the medicine dissolve and retort into the retort. This method is mostly used for refining light salt, table salt, sodium hydroxide, etc.

Kuxitai method has the following six main functions: 1. Reduce or eliminate the toxicity or side effects of drugs; 2. Change and ease the drug properties and sexual grade; 3. Improve the curative effect; 4. Easy to adjust, prepare and preserve; 5. Ensure the purity of drugs; 6. Easy to take.
